From a performance stand point, excess body fat lowers your work to weight ratio, This means that a heavier person would consume more energy per minute of work resulting in a lower energy economy during activity.

In addition, excess body fat can lead to additional loads placed on joint during weight bearing activities such as running, causing joint distress. Healthy or athletic body fat percentages typically allow for more optimal performances, due to the improved economy and reduced injuries.

The immune system is often impaired when body fat stores are too low. A reduced ability to fight infections means more interruptions in training and more chance of being sick on race day.

For female athletes, there are some very immediate consequences of a low body fat level, including a fall in circulating oestrogen levels. This in turn can lead to a loss of bone mass, causing problems for women in later life through an increased risk of bone fracture. Assessing body fat can be done using the following methodologies: Hydrostatic weighing, skinfold assessment and bio-electrical impedance.

Of these methods, one that is both accurate and practical is skinfold measurement. The measurements are taken with calipers, which gauge the skinfold thickness in millimeters of areas where fat typically accumulates i. Once the measurements are recorded, the numbers are inserted into an equation that calculates a body fat percentage and alternatively body lean mass.

Skinfold is a preferred method of body fat measurement for non-clinical settings because it is easy to administer with proven accuracy and is not obtrusive with regards to the patient.

It also provides much more data than just the final composition measurement - it also yields the thickness of many sites, which can be used as bases of comparison with future results.

For example, an abdominal skinfold improvement from 35mm to 24mm would show a significant improvement in that site even if the overall body fat percentage may have only reduced minimally.

BMI is often mistaken as measurable guide to body fat. However, BMI is simply a weight to height ratio. It is a tool for indicating weight status in adults and general health in large populations.

BMI correlates mildly with body fat but when used in conjunction with a body fat measurement gives a very accurate presentation of your current weight status. With that being said, an elevated BMI above 30 significantly increases your risk of developing long-term and disabling conditions such as hypertension, diabetes mellitus, gallstones, stroke, osteoarthritis, and some forms of cancer.

Body fat scales or smart scales are popular amongst those who want an easy way to monitor their body composition regularly at home. Unlike traditional scales that only measure body weight, body fat scales combine weight scales with something called a foot-to-foot impedance meter FFI The FFI estimates body fat and muscle mass by sending electrical currents to the body and measuring the response.

Muscle and fat respond differently to electrical currents, and the scale uses these differences to determine body fat. Even though this method is one of the simplest ways to estimate body fat in a home setting, there are some drawbacks to using smart scales.

A study compared the accuracy of three smart scales in measuring body weight and composition in underweight, normal weight, and overweight adults against DEXA. The researchers found that although body weight was accurately measured by the scales, body fat was underestimated One of the issues with smart scales is that their accuracy depends on the body composition of the population used to train the smart scale during production.

Plus, accuracy can vary widely between smart scale models Smart scales use a foot-to-foot impedance meter FFI to measure body composition. They can be used as an at-home method for body fat measurement, but their accuracy varies significantly. Skinfold measurements involve the use of special calipers that measure the skinfold—subcutaneous fat—on different parts of your body. The DEXA scan, or dual-energy X-ray absorptiometry scan, uses a low-level X-ray to measure bone, muscle, and body fat.

Hydrostatic weighing involves full submersion in a water tank, using water displacement to measure body composition.

Since fat floats and muscle sinks, a person with more lean body mass weighs more underwater. Bod pod is similar to hydrostatic weighing, but uses air displacement instead of water displacement to measure body composition. For this test, you sit in an egg-shaped chamber, which uses your body weight and volume to determine your body composition.

Most body water is stored in muscle. Therefore, if a person is more muscular there is a high chance that the person will also have more body water, which leads to lower impedance.

Since the advent of the first commercially available devices in the mids the method has become popular owing to its ease of use and portability of the equipment.

It is familiar in the consumer market as a simple instrument for estimating body fat. BIA [1] actually determines the electrical impedance , or opposition to the flow of an electric current through body tissues which can then be used to estimate total body water TBW , which can be used to estimate fat-free body mass and, by difference with body weight, body fat.

Many of the early research studies showed that BIA was quite variable and it was not regarded by many as providing an accurate measure of body composition. In recent years [ when? Although the instruments are straightforward to use, careful attention to the method of use as described by the manufacturer should be given.

Simple devices to estimate body fat, often using BIA, are available to consumers as body fat meters. These instruments are generally regarded as being less accurate than those used clinically or in nutritional and medical practice.

Dehydration is a recognized factor affecting BIA measurements as it causes an increase in the body's electrical resistance , so has been measured to cause a 5 kg underestimation of fat-free mass i. an overestimation of body fat. Body fat measurements are lower when measurements are taken shortly after consumption of a meal, causing a variation between highest and lowest readings of body fat percentage taken throughout the day of up to 4.

Moderate exercise before BIA measurements lead to an overestimation of fat-free mass and an underestimation of body fat percentage due to reduced impedance.

body fat is significantly underestimated. BIA is considered reasonably accurate for measuring groups, of limited accuracy for tracking body composition in an individual over a period of time, but is not considered sufficiently accurate for recording of single measurements of individuals.

Consumer grade devices for measuring BIA have not been found to be sufficiently accurate for single measurement use, and are better suited for use to measure changes in body composition over time for individuals. Multiple electrodes, typically eight, may be used located on the hands and feet allowing measurement of the impedance of the individual body segments - arms, legs and torso.

The advantage of the multiple electrode devices is that body segments may be measured simultaneously without the need to relocate electrodes. Results for some impedance instruments tested found poor limits of agreement and in some cases systematic bias in estimation of visceral fat percentage, but good accuracy in the prediction of resting energy expenditure REE when compared with more accurate whole-body magnetic resonance imaging MRI and dual-energy X-ray absorptiometry DXA.

Impedance is frequency sensitive; at low frequency the electric current flows preferentially through extracellular water ECW only while at high frequency the current can cross cell membranes and hence flows through total body water TBW.

In bioimpedance spectroscopy devices BIS resistance at zero and infinite frequency can be estimated and, at least theoretically, should provide the optimal predictors of ECW and TBW and hence body fat-free mass respectively.

In practice, the improvement in accuracy is marginal. The use of multiple frequencies or BIS in specific BIA devices has been shown to have high correlation with DXA when measuring body fat percentage. The electrical properties of tissues have been described since These properties were further described for a wider range of frequencies on a larger range of tissues, including those that were damaged or undergoing change after death.

In , Thomasset conducted the original studies using electrical impedance measurements as an index of total body water TBW , using two subcutaneously inserted needles.

In , Hoffer concluded that a whole-body impedance measurement could predict total body water. The equation the squared value of height divided by impedance measurements of the right half of the body showed a correlation coefficient of 0.

This equation, Hoffer proved, is known as the impedance index used in BIA. In , Nyober validated the use of whole body electrical impedance to assess body composition.

By the s the foundations of BIA were established, including those that underpinned the relationships between the impedance and the body water content of the body.

A variety of single-frequency BIA analyzers then became commercially available, such as RJL Systems and its first commercialized impedance meter.

In the s, Lukaski, Segal, and other researchers discovered that the use of a single frequency 50 kHz in BIA assumed the human body to be a single cylinder, which created many technical limitations in BIA. The use of a single frequency was inaccurate for populations that did not have the standard body type.

To improve the accuracy of BIA, researchers created empirical equations using empirical data gender, age, ethnicity to predict a user's body composition. In , Lukaski published empirical equations using the impedance index, body weight, and reactance.

In , Kushner and Scholler published empirical equations using the impedance index, body weight, and gender. However, empirical equations were only useful in predicting the average population's body composition and was inaccurate for medical purposes for populations with diseases.

The use of multiple frequencies would also distinguish intracellular and extracellular water. By the s, the market included several multi-frequency analyzers and a couple of BIS devices. The use of BIA as a bedside method has increased because the equipment is portable and safe, the procedure is simple and noninvasive, and the results are reproducible and rapidly obtained.

More recently, segmental BIA has been developed to overcome inconsistencies between resistance R and the body mass of the trunk. In , an eight-polar stand-on BIA device, InBody , that did not utilize empirical equations was created and was found to "offer accurate estimates of TBW and ECW in women without the need of population-specific formulas.

In , AURA Devices brought the fitness tracker AURA Band with built-in BIA. In BIA became available for Apple Watch users with the accessory AURA Strap with built-in sensors. The impedance of cellular tissue can be modeled as a resistor representing the extracellular path in parallel with a resistor and capacitor in series representing the intracellular path, the resistance that of intracellular fluid and the capacitor the cell membrane.

This results in a change in impedance versus the frequency used in the measurement. Whole body impedance measurement is generally measured from the wrist to the ipsilateral ankle and uses either two rarely or four overwhelmingly electrodes.

In the 2-electrode bipolar configuration a small current on the order of μA is passed between two electrodes, and the voltage is measured between the same whereas in the tetrapolar arrangement resistance is measured between as separate pair of proximally located electrodes.

The tetrapolar arrangement is preferred since measurement is not confounded by the impedance of the skin-electrode interface [23].

In bioelectrical impedance analysis in humans, an estimate of the phase angle can be obtained and is based on changes in resistance and reactance as alternating current passes through tissues, which causes a phase shift.

Most diets focus on body weight and weight loss over maintaining healthy body composition. Your body composition is the percentage of body fat, muscle, bone, and other tissues. Read on to understand what body composition means and why physical fitness is preferable to weight loss.

Body composition is the term used in the fitness and health community to refer to the percentage of fat, water, bone, muscle, skin, and other lean tissues that make up the body. Typically, people break body composition into two groups: fat mass and fat-free mass.

Fat mass is the amount of body fat. Fat-free mass is all the lean tissues in your body like muscles, organs, bone, water, etc. Body mass index BMI is another popular term used in the medical and health community to describe body measurements.

Body composition is different from body mass index because BMI focuses on how your whole body weight compares to your height.

BMI is calculated by taking total body mass in kilograms kg and dividing it by height in meters m squared. The number is then put into a chart to find the category.

The BMI categories include:. Many athletic people with high muscle mass and low body fat percentage may fall into the overweight or obese categories. Body composition and body fat percentage may better predict health risks than simple obesity classification based on BMI.

A healthier body composition is a higher percentage of lean tissue and a lower percentage of body fat. Body composition is important because it can give you a better idea of your health risk, especially if you fall in the overweight or obesity category for BMI because you have more muscle and lean tissue.

Body composition is measured using tools to estimate your body fat percentage. The ways to measure body composition vary. Some are more accessible but may be less accurate, while others may be harder to access and more accurate.

Here are different ways body composition is measured. Skinfold measurements use a special type of caliper tool designed to measure the thickness of a skinfold. It's done by gently pinching the skin and fat under the skin on several body parts.

Skinfold measurements are usually done on the following:. This type of measurement is accurate. However, there is a large possibility of "user error" if the person performing the test doesn't have proper training. Body circumference or waist circumference measurements are a simple and easy way to estimate body fat.

It uses a tape measure to see how wide around specific body parts are. Circumference is often assessed on body parts like the waist, arms, chest, thighs, and hips. Research suggests carrying more weight on your abdomen is associated with an increased risk for health problems. The circumference method helps assess the risk for disease based on the weight you carry on your belly.

However, this method may not be the best if your goal is to assess your overall body fat percentage because it only measures the circumference and not the percentage of fat and muscle. The dual energy X-ray absorptiometry scan, known as a DEXA scan , uses low-energy X-rays to accurately measure the weight of bone, muscle, and body fat.

After the scan, you receive an assessment of your bone density , body fat percentage, and mass of each body part. Many professionals consider the DEXA scan the gold standard for measuring muscle mass.

However, it can be harder to find a place to have a DEXA scan done depending on where you live, and it may be a more expensive option. Hydrostatic weighing measures the water displacement when someone is fully submerged in water. Hydrostatic weighing was long considered the gold standard for assessing body composition until other methods, like DEXA scans, were developed.

While this method is accurate, some people find it difficult to stay submerged in water long enough for the assessment, and it may not be accessible. A bioimpedance analysis BIA uses a painless, low-energy electrical current to assess fat mass, muscle mass, and hydration water mass.

Muscle contains more water than fat, so it conducts the energy current better than fat. Fat tissue impedes the movement of the current. The BIA scanner can assess body composition based on how the energy moves through the body.

This test tends to cost less and may be easier to find than other types of scans. However, the accuracy of this assessment changes based on how hydrated you are.

If you drink too much water before the test, you could appear leaner than you are. Some other methods of assessing body composition include:.
